Opg Power Ventures Plc is listed in the Electric Services s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ker OPG. The last closing price for Opg Power Ventures was 10.25p. Over the last year, Opg Power Ventures shares have traded in a share price range of 8.00p to 14.25p.

Opg Power Ventures currently has 400,733,511 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Opg Power Ventures is £41.08 million. Opg Power Ventures has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 5.51.

Thanks for the link jailbird, very interesting read.

Of the two options suggested, what do holders on here think?

1) Reposition the company completely. Divest of the Thermal Power Plant and invest in renewable projects in India. The divestment will yield multiples of the market cap in cash so as long as Management allocate the cash effectively, buying assets at sensible valuations, this would create immediate value. Becoming a renewable player would open the pool of institutional investors once again for OPG.

2) Share buybacks + Dividends. Now that debt is fully paid off (albeit there might be a convertible loan note being issued in the short term, unclear what the purpose of this is for), the business generates ample cash on an annual basis (refer graphs above). Doing share buybacks and paying dividends has the potential to signal to the market the belief in the company as well as attract yield focused investors.
